I ran w/ Kamikaze A-33 from 1990-94 (29' Mirage). I believe Haulin' Glass used to be that (A) boat. Pat had a B-33, also a 29' mirage called Kamikaze, previous to the A boat (86-88). That boat I believe went down to Fla. and is the one that burned to the waterline. I am tearing my house apart looking for pictures, I know I have a ton.
